: Generally charges the Manufacturer’s Suggested Retail Price (MSRP). The main benefits are the LEGO Insiders program, which offers roughly 5% back in points (10% during "Double Points" events), and exclusive "Gift with Purchase" (GWP) items.

: Frequently offer sets at 10%–20% below MSRP. Prices at Target often match Amazon.
